Форум программистов
 
Контакты: о проблемах с регистрацией, почтой и по другим вопросам п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ail.

Вернуться   Форум программистов > Web > Общие вопросы Web
Регистрация

Восстановить пароль
Повторная активизация e-mail

Здесь нужно купить рекламу за 20 тыс руб в месяц! ) пишите сюда - alarforum@yandex.ru
Без учёта ботов - 20000 человек в день, 350000 в месяц.

Ответ
 
Опции темы
Старый 09.06.2017, 01:03   #1
Feeddie
Пользователь
 
Регистрация: 11.04.2017
Сообщений: 28
По умолчанию Актуально ли? Backend на Node.JS или на php? Стоит ли изучать NodeJS?

Здравствуите. В общем, задался я тут вопросом. Я хочу разрабатывать саиты как на стороне клиента, так и на стороне сервера. Долгое время программировал на php, но понял в итоге, что php вызывает у меня только скуку и грусть, но зато я просто обожаю javascript, а библиотека джиКуэри - это вообще любовь пожизненно.

Так вот, узнал я о такои вещи как Node.JS и сразу же приглянулась мне она, особенно мне приглянулись компоненты gulp, sass и Express для серверных запросов. Выглядит все довольно сложно и хотелось бы услышать советы гуру.

Стоит ли? И где искать уроки по даннои среде?
Feeddie вне форума   Ответить с цитированием
Старый 09.06.2017, 01:12   #2
Alex11223
Модератор
Заслуженный модератор
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,488
По умолчанию

Цитата:
Сообщение от Feeddie Посмотреть сообщение
gulp, sass
причем тут серверная часть и особенно запросы?
Alex11223 на форуме   Ответить с цитированием
Старый 09.06.2017, 07:58   #3
Feeddie
Пользователь
 
Регистрация: 11.04.2017
Сообщений: 28
По умолчанию

Цитата:
Сообщение от Alex11223 Посмотреть сообщение
причем тут серверная часть и особенно запросы?
Я сказал, что Express для серверных запросов, а gulp, sass - они мне нравятся как неотъемлемая часть
Feeddie вне форума   Ответить с цитированием
Старый 09.06.2017, 09:24   #4
Alex11223
Модератор
Заслуженный модератор
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,488
По умолчанию

Часть чего? Для npm, gulp/grunt и sass не нужен сервер, и наверно даже большинство людей использующих это не используют сервер на Node.JS.

sass вообще не имеет никакого отношения к JS.
Alex11223 на форуме   Ответить с цитированием
Старый 09.06.2017, 10:40   #5
Feeddie
Пользователь
 
Регистрация: 11.04.2017
Сообщений: 28
По умолчанию

Цитата:
Сообщение от Alex11223 Посмотреть сообщение
Часть чего? Для npm, gulp/grunt и sass не нужен сервер, и наверно даже большинство людей использующих это не используют сервер на Node.JS.

sass вообще не имеет никакого отношения к JS.
Я не понимаю. Я вопрос неправильно поставил? Я сказал, что мне нравится Node JS, нравятся его компоненты и у нее(у ноды) существует фреймворк Express, который позволяет на языке JS создавать запросы, а благодаря MangoDB есть возможность использовать NoSQL и хранить данные, вместо аналога php+MySQL. зачем из себя мастера корчить? Все элементарно и понятно задано. Ответить надо было лишь на вопрос "backend на js или на php? Стоит ли изучать NodeJS?". Зачем фигнёй заниматься и время тратить? Я сказал лишь какие компоненты мне понравились в данной среде. Я знаю для чего они предназначены. Вопрос идёт о серверной части, и услышав NodeJS всем опытным людям должно быть понятно, что сказать в ответ. Мы говорим не о sass, я лишь упомянул его, но вопросы на счёт этого препроцессора для css я не задаю

Последний раз редактировалось Serge_Bliznykov; 09.06.2017 в 10:50. Причина: <цензура>
Feeddie вне форума   Ответить с цитированием
Старый 09.06.2017, 10:56   #6
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,263
По умолчанию

Цитата:
Сообщение от Feeddie Посмотреть сообщение
Я вопрос неправильно поставил?
неправильно.
вот, на примере.
Раньше строил из кирпича. А увидел, что дом можно строить из дерева.Кто нибудь строит из дерева? Это актуально? Я в деревянном доме на стенке видел плазменную панель отличную, мне очень понравилась.

аналогия понятная и уместна, надеюсь?

и ещё, Вам тут никто ничего не должен.
Захотят люди высказать СВОЁ мнение, они его выскажут. Нет - значит, нет.
А ругань и флейм тут устраивать не стоит.
Serge_Bliznykov вне форума   Ответить с цитированием
Старый 09.06.2017, 11:05   #7
ADSoft
Старожил
 
Регистрация: 25.02.2007
Сообщений: 3,468
По умолчанию

главное - если нравится, изучай и применяй. Есть большой класс задач который на Node делается красиво и без проблем. Есть наоборот. Но делается все на всем )
ADSoft вне форума   Ответить с цитированием
Старый 09.06.2017, 11:07   #8
Alex11223
Модератор
Заслуженный модератор
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,488
По умолчанию

Так вы ж говорите
Цитата:
Сообщение от Feeddie Посмотреть сообщение
Выглядит все довольно сложно
Одно из определений слова "сложный" — состоящий из нескольких частей/компонентов.

Вот я и говорю, что можно не мешать все в кучу потому что далеко не все связанное с Node.JS относится к бекенду и никто не мешает все эти вещи использовать с РНР (что многие и делают).

Вообще про "только скуку и грусть" не очень понятно. РНР используется для разных вещей, а не только для вордпресса и битрикса
В нем как и в других языках есть современные фреймворки типа Laravel, Symfony если вы это хотели.
Alex11223 на форуме   Ответить с цитированием
Старый 09.06.2017, 11:17   #9
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,095
По умолчанию

Мне вот интересно, почему такие интересующиеся "актуально или нет" идут первым делом не посмотреть на вакансии и предложения фриланса, а на какой-то форум?..
Запомните раз и навсегда: помочь != "решите за меня"!
p51x вне форума   Ответить с цитированием
Старый 09.06.2017, 20:14   #10
Feeddie
Пользователь
 
Регистрация: 11.04.2017
Сообщений: 28
По умолчанию

Цитата:
Сообщение от p51x Посмотреть сообщение
Мне вот интересно, почему такие интересующиеся "актуально или нет" идут первым делом не посмотреть на вакансии и предложения фриланса, а на какой-то форум?..
Я смотрел. Я знаю даже, что по статистике оно вполне может обойти php, но ответ от живых людей все же убедительнее
Feeddie вне форума   Ответить с цитированием
Ответ
Опции темы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
C++. Стоит ли изучать? jonikster Общие вопросы C/C++ 45 18.12.2015 14:53
C#. Стоит ли изучать? jonikster C# (си шарп) 2 12.12.2015 15:36
Онлайн игра на Node.js + SockJS или socket.io / Node.js freerunner JavaScript, Ajax 2 17.04.2014 11:01
Что лучше изучать Php или javascript? Arassir PHP 15 14.07.2009 19:21
Стоит ли изучать С#? Игорь007 Свободное общение 30 20.06.2008 14:08